
The Freestar lags behind the minivan competition and lacks any price advantage before incentives are figured in. It features a third-row seat that folds flat into the floor when not in use. The second-row seats are too low. Stability control is available. The engines are rough and noisy. Handling is secure but the ride is unsettled. Fit and finish trails the class leaders. Consumer Reports Bottom Line Price
The Consumer Reports Bottom Line Price is the dealer invoice minus any holdbacks, national dealer incentives, and customer rebates.
